This years Hartland quay hillclimbs @ Hartland quay north devon , take place on the 20th March and the 2nd of October ,
Hartland quay is right up on the very north west corner of devon , watch bikes and sidecar outfits try to go the quickest up the hill , to get there folow A39 until you see a sign for hartland , ride into village follow signs for the quay
